... Что такое запросы в системах управления базами данных. Погружение в мир запросов к базам данных: подробный гайд
Статьи

Что такое запросы в системах управления базами данных

Что такое запросы в системах управления базами данных? 🧮

Запросы — это не просто инструменты, а настоящие магические ключи 🗝️, открывающие доступ к сокровищницам информации, хранящимся в базах данных. Представьте себе огромную библиотеку 📚, где каждая книга — это таблица с данными. Запросы — это ваши личные библиотекари 🧙‍♂️, которые умеют находить нужную вам информацию с невероятной скоростью и точностью.

Они не только умеют извлекать данные из одной или нескольких таблиц, но и способны вносить изменения в саму структуру базы данных, словно волшебники, переписывающие страницы книг. 🪄

Более того, запросы служат источником данных для различных инструментов, таких как формы, отчеты и страницы доступа к данным. Они подобны трубопроводу 🚰, который доставляет информацию туда, где она нужна.

Что такое запрос к базе данных? 🖥️

Запрос к базе данных можно представить как обращение к хранилищу информации с определенной целью. Это как задать вопрос 🙋‍♂️ базе данных и получить на него ответ. Запросы могут быть простыми, например, поиск информации о конкретном клиенте 🧑‍💼, или сложными, включающими вычисления, объединение данных из разных таблиц и даже изменение самих данных.

Примеры использования запросов:
  • Получение ответа на простой вопрос: «Сколько клиентов проживает в Москве?» 🏙️
  • Выполнение расчетов: «Какова средняя сумма заказа за последний месяц?» 💰
  • Объединение данных из разных таблиц: «Вывести список клиентов и их заказов» 🛍️
  • Добавление, изменение или удаление данных: «Добавить нового клиента в базу данных» ➕

Для чего служат запросы в БД? 🗂️

Запросы — это незаменимые помощники при работе с базами данных, особенно в Access. Они значительно упрощают работу с информацией, позволяя легко просматривать, добавлять, удалять и изменять данные.

Основные преимущества использования запросов:
  • Быстрый поиск данных: Запросы позволяют мгновенно находить нужную информацию, даже в огромных объемах данных. 🔎
  • Вычисления и обобщение данных: С помощью запросов можно проводить различные вычисления, например, суммировать значения, находить среднее значение или группировать данные по определенному признаку. 📊
  • Автоматизация задач: Запросы позволяют автоматизировать рутинные операции, такие как обновление данных или создание отчетов. 🤖

Что значит «по запросу»? ❔

Фраза «цена по запросу» часто встречается в сфере продаж. Это означает, что цена на товар или услугу не указана публично, а предоставляется только по запросу потенциального клиента.

Причины использования такой тактики:
  • Индивидуальный подход: Цена может зависеть от различных факторов, таких как объем заказа, условия доставки или специфика клиента.
  • Конкурентная стратегия: Компания может не хотеть раскрывать свои цены конкурентам.
  • Сложность ценообразования: Цена может быть трудно определима заранее, например, в случае сложных проектов или услуг.

Что представляют собой SQL запросы? 💻

SQL (Structured Query Language) — это специальный язык программирования, предназначенный для работы с реляционными базами данных. Реляционные базы данных хранят информацию в виде таблиц, где строки представляют отдельные записи, а столбцы — атрибуты этих записей. SQL позволяет взаимодействовать с этими таблицами, извлекать данные, изменять их и управлять структурой базы данных.

Основные особенности SQL:
  • Стандартизированный язык: SQL используется большинством СУБД, что обеспечивает совместимость и переносимость данных.
  • Мощный и гибкий: SQL позволяет выполнять сложные операции с данными, включая объединение таблиц, фильтрацию, сортировку и агрегацию.
  • Декларативный язык: В SQL вы описываете, что хотите получить, а не как это сделать. СУБД сама оптимизирует выполнение запроса.

Что такое система управления базами данных простыми словами? 🗄️

Система управления базами данных (СУБД) — это набор программ, которые позволяют создавать, управлять и администрировать базы данных. Представьте себе СУБД как супер-организатора 🗂️, который следит за порядком в огромном хранилище информации.

Основные функции СУБД:
  • Создание и изменение структуры базы данных: Определение таблиц, столбцов, типов данных и связей между ними.
  • Добавление, изменение и удаление данных: Работа с информацией, хранящейся в базе данных.
  • Управление доступом к данным: Определение прав пользователей на просмотр, изменение и удаление данных.
  • Обеспечение целостности и безопасности данных: Защита данных от ошибок и несанкционированного доступа.

Какие виды запросов бывают в базе данных? 📦

Запросы можно разделить на два основных типа:

  • Запросы на выборку: Эти запросы предназначены для извлечения данных из базы данных. Они подобны поисковым запросам в интернете 🌐, которые помогают найти нужную информацию.
  • Запросы на изменение: Эти запросы используются для изменения данных в базе данных, например, для добавления новых записей, обновления существующих или удаления ненужных. Они подобны инструментам редактирования ✏️, которые позволяют изменять содержимое базы данных.

Выбор типа запроса зависит от задачи, которую вы хотите решить.

Что такое Query? 🔍

В контексте баз данных, Query (запрос) — это объект, который позволяет графически задать SQL запрос к базе данных. Это как визуальный конструктор 🏗️ запросов, который упрощает их создание и редактирование.

Преимущества использования Query:
  • Наглядность: Графический интерфейс Query позволяет легко понять структуру запроса и связи между таблицами.
  • Простота использования: Query не требует глубоких знаний SQL, что делает его доступным для широкого круга пользователей.
  • Гибкость: Query позволяет создавать сложные запросы, включая объединение таблиц, фильтрацию, сортировку и агрегацию.

Полезные советы по работе с запросами: 💡

  • Планируйте свои запросы: Прежде чем создавать запрос, четко определите, какую информацию вы хотите получить или какие изменения внести.
  • Используйте понятные имена для запросов: Это поможет вам легко ориентироваться в своих запросах.
  • Тестируйте свои запросы: Убедитесь, что запрос возвращает корректные данные или выполняет нужные действия.
  • Документируйте свои запросы: Добавляйте комментарии, объясняющие логику работы запроса.

Выводы: 🎯

Запросы — это мощный инструмент для работы с базами данных. Они позволяют извлекать информацию, изменять данные, автоматизировать задачи и получать ценные insights. Понимание принципов работы с запросами открывает широкие возможности для эффективного использования баз данных в различных сферах деятельности.

FAQ: ❓

  • Что такое запрос в базе данных? Запрос — это обращение к базе данных с целью получения информации или выполнения действий с данными.
  • Какие виды запросов бывают? Основные виды запросов — это запросы на выборку и запросы на изменение.
  • Что такое SQL? SQL — это язык программирования для работы с реляционными базами данных.
  • Что такое Query? Query — это объект, который позволяет графически задать SQL запрос.
  • Зачем нужны запросы? Запросы упрощают работу с базами данных, позволяя быстро находить информацию, выполнять вычисления, автоматизировать задачи и многое другое.
Какие методы психологии среди теоретических являются основными
Вверх